Cluster Affiliation Model for Local Community Detection

Most community detection studies utilize the entire network to mine all communities. However, in practice, the whole network is often expensive to get or even unavailable. Besides, users may only concern the community containing the node they are interested in. To this end, local community detection emerges. Existing approaches based on Non-negative Matrix Factorization need to set parameters to extract subgraphs around the given node and detect overlapping communities rather than detecting one community for a given node. Therefore, in this paper, a novel parameter-free method, called LCAM (Cluster Affiliation Model for Local community detection), is proposed. It fits the edges in the network to obtain the affiliation of nodes and uses affiliation of nodes to gradually expand outward from the starting node to get the local community, instead of extracting a subgraph from networks before detecting local communities. Four real-world and five synthetic networks are adopted to test LCAM and experimental results demonstrate that LCAM yields better community structure than comparison algorithms.

[1]  Deng Cai,et al.  LookCom: Learning Optimal Network for Community Detection , 2022, IEEE Transactions on Knowledge and Data Engineering.

[2]  Ran Cheng,et al.  A parallel multi-objective evolutionary algorithm for community detection in large-scale complex networks , 2021, Inf. Sci..

[3]  Meizi Li,et al.  A Community Detection Method for Social Network Based on Community Embedding , 2021, IEEE Transactions on Computational Social Systems.

[4]  Timothy C. Havens,et al.  Linear Time Community Detection by a Novel Modularity Gain Acceleration in Label Propagation , 2020, IEEE Transactions on Big Data.

[5]  Gautam Srivastava,et al.  Information Granulation-Based Community Detection for Social Networks , 2020, IEEE Transactions on Computational Social Systems.

[6]  Nannan Lu,et al.  Multiscale Local Community Detection in Social Networks , 2019, IEEE Transactions on Knowledge and Data Engineering.

[7]  Jiawei Zhang,et al.  CommDGI: Community Detection Oriented Deep Graph Infomax , 2020, CIKM.

[8]  Li Ni,et al.  Local community detection by the nearest nodes with greater centrality , 2020, Inf. Sci..

[9]  Li Ni,et al.  Mining the Local Dependency Itemset in a Products Network , 2020, ACM Trans. Manag. Inf. Syst..

[10]  Kun He,et al.  Sparse Nonnegative Matrix Factorization for Multiple-Local-Community Detection , 2020, IEEE Transactions on Computational Social Systems.

[11]  Wenjian Luo,et al.  Local Overlapping Community Detection , 2019, ACM Trans. Knowl. Discov. Data.

[12]  Zhengyou Xia,et al.  A two-stage BFS local community detection algorithm based on node transfer similarity and Local Clustering Coefficient , 2020 .

[13]  Hongzhi Wang,et al.  Effective and Efficient Community Search Over Large Directed Graphs , 2019, IEEE Transactions on Knowledge and Data Engineering.

[14]  Kun He,et al.  A Nonnegative Matrix Factorization Approach for Multiple Local Community Detection , 2018, 2018 IEEE/ACM International Conference on Advances in Social Networks Analysis and Mining (ASONAM).

[15]  Hao Jiang,et al.  Local Community Detection With the Dynamic Membership Function , 2018, IEEE Transactions on Fuzzy Systems.

[16]  Andreas Spitz,et al.  Community Detection in Partially Observable Social Networks , 2017, ACM Trans. Knowl. Discov. Data.

[17]  Cristopher Moore,et al.  The Computer Science and Physics of Community Detection: Landscapes, Phase Transitions, and Hardness , 2017, Bull. EATCS.

[18]  Punam Bedi,et al.  Community detection in social networks , 2016, WIREs Data Mining Knowl. Discov..

[19]  David F. Gleich,et al.  Heat kernel based community detection , 2014, KDD.

[20]  Luciano da F. Costa,et al.  Robustness of community structure to node removal , 2013, 1308.6295.

[21]  Jure Leskovec,et al.  Overlapping community detection at scale: a nonnegative matrix factorization approach , 2013, WSDM.

[22]  Jure Leskovec,et al.  Defining and evaluating network communities based on ground-truth , 2012, Knowledge and Information Systems.

[23]  Inderjit S. Dhillon,et al.  Fast coordinate descent methods with variable selection for non-negative matrix factorization , 2011, KDD.

[24]  F. Radicchi,et al.  Benchmark graphs for testing community detection algorithms. , 2008, Physical review. E, Statistical, nonlinear, and soft matter physics.

[25]  Jean-Loup Guillaume,et al.  Fast unfolding of communities in large networks , 2008, 0803.0476.

[26]  Feng Luo,et al.  Exploring Local Community Structures in Large Networks , 2006, 2006 IEEE/WIC/ACM International Conference on Web Intelligence (WI 2006 Main Conference Proceedings)(WI'06).

[27]  Vladimir Batagelj,et al.  Exploratory Social Network Analysis with Pajek: Revised and Expanded Edition for Updated Software , 2018 .

[28]  A. Clauset Finding local community structure in networks. , 2005, Physical review. E, Statistical, nonlinear, and soft matter physics.

[29]  M. Newman Fast algorithm for detecting community structure in networks. , 2003, Physical review. E, Statistical, nonlinear, and soft matter physics.

[30]  David Lusseau,et al.  The emergent properties of a dolphin social network , 2003, Proceedings of the Royal Society of London. Series B: Biological Sciences.

[31]  Michael I. Jordan,et al.  On Spectral Clustering: Analysis and an algorithm , 2001, NIPS.